Summary of Dare to Care Inspection Results
-
The Dare to Care inspection has been completed, and our pantry not only passed but was praised as the “gold standard” among all Dare to Care Food Pantries.
-
Thank you to everyone who contributed in these key areas:
-
Donating, transporting, and picking up food from Dare to Care and neighboring parishes
-
Inspecting expiration dates and stocking shelves
-
Rotating inventory and maintaining correct refrigerator/freezer temperatures
-
Bagging and distributing food to our neighbors
-
Engaging with pantry visitors and sharing the volunteer experience with friends
-
Providing overall leadership in serving the hungry—one of the Corporal Works of Mercy
